We just got our 2.5i. Topaz Gold Automatic (the wife needs to drive it). I LOVE the car and I come from owning a modded WRX. It handles way better than my stock wrx did and it is not nearly as slow as the Outback is thank God. The color is amazing and I wish they made it for the wrx. My only gripe is the light colored interior. Although it is very nice, you have to be really careful with it. I think i am gonna scotchguard ours this weekend. I am going to get the Splashguards, the rear Bumper Protector, and the rubber trunk tray. Eventually I would like to get new wheels and a sportgrille, however I don't know if this will ever happen. I'd rather save for our next car which will probably be another turbo suby. I love this car though and I do not care that it's an auto because it is still a lot of fun to drive. Picked up an 08 2.5i Auto in Dark Metallic Grey also got the premium package.

This is my first awd and I love it. The grip is just appalling, who knew having 2 extra wheels could make such a big difference. With the recent rain here on the west coast, I feel safe driving this impreza.
On top of the awd, the suspension is nice and comfortable over ill-maintained roads. Larger than avg sized speed bumps..what are they? Initially, I was worried about it being too soft;body roll. But after I grew a few big ones, I discovered that the car could handle and grip amazingly.
